Discusión: Electrónica Proyecto OpenPlotter
Ver mensaje
  #481  
Antiguo 23-03-2015, 10:43
Avatar de alcapar
alcapar alcapar esta desconectado
Corsario
 
Registrado: 27-10-2006
Localización: Golfo de Cádiz y Algarve
Mensajes: 1,847
Agradecimientos que ha otorgado: 415
Recibió 395 Agradecimientos en 247 Mensajes
Sexo:
Predeterminado Re: Proyecto OpenPlotter

Cita:
Originalmente publicado por sailoog.com Ver mensaje


Ya verás como la curva de aprendizaje de python es bastante rápida y gratificante.

Unos cuantos mensajes mas atrás comento que estoy precisamente en lo mismo así que te explico como lo estoy haciendo por si te sirve de ayuda.

Para la comunicación con el IMU para el compas electronico estoy usando estas librerias:https://github.com/richards-tech/RTIMULib que son tanto para C++ como para python. estas librerias tambien están preparadas para leer presión y temperatura de los chips BMP180, LPS25H, MS5611(el tuyo es el modelo antiguo del BMP180 y como el firmware es el mismo debería funcionar igual).

si quieres efectividad te recomiendo estas librerias porque son compatibles y automáticas con la mayoria de chips y con 5 lineas de python ya estás leyendo desde ellos. si lo que quieres es afianzar conocimientos mejor las librerias de adafruit.

En cuanto a la representación gráfica de los datos te recomiendo almacenar datos en csv y crear las gráficas con matplotlib ya que es lo mas facil y potente. Yo supongo que haré algo parecido a esta imagen con las dos lineas de presion y temperatura:

en internet encontrarás multitud de tutoriales de matplotlib básicos y avanzados.

Por cierto ¿tienes idea del intervalo de tiempo adecuado para que se pueda ver claramente la evolución?

Gracias por los consejos.

Me van a prestar un sensor para las pruebas pero todavía no sé el modelo exacto.

Respecto a la escala de tiempos, he pensado tomar un valor de Presión y Temperatura cada 5 minutos, para la temperatura representaré este valor, sin embargo, para la presión representaré el valor medio cada media hora en un gráfico de barras.

Ya estoy buscando un sensor de corriente continua para disponer de un monitor de consumo eléctrico, esta aplicación es todavía más sencilla y nos permitirá monitorizar la demanda.

Los siguientes cofrades agradecieron este mensaje a alcapar
sailoog.com (23-03-2015)